In the past two years, more than $7B has been invested in Spanish startups.  A rapidly growing technology industry is driving optimism and creating new global champions for the Spanish economy.  Companies like JobandTalent, Carto, Devo, and Flywire all begun in Spain and grew to markets around the world.  

Yet, there is almost no North American investment capital.  Madrid and Barcelona rank behind cities like London, Berlin, and Paris in both capital invested and unicorns created.  Is that a lagging indicator? Or is there a structural reason Spain cannot compete in global venture capital markets? 

Investing in Spain is a series of conversations with the leaders of the startup community in Spain. We talk with the prominent investors, entrepreneurs and partners building the Spanish technology industry.  We explore the challenges, and the opportunities, that lie ahead.  The goal is to provide a global audience an introduction to Spanish VC, a snapshot of the people, firms and strategies defining this period of growth and transition.
